摘要
Regioselective radical addition of 4-cyanotoluenethiol (1a) to enynes 3-6 leads to vinyl radicals 7-10 that can undergo five- or six-membered cyclization onto styrene or terminal double bonds in competition with 5-exo cyclization onto the aryl ring, The latter affords spiro-cyclohexadienyl radical intermediates which can either be trapped by 2-cyanoisopropyl radicals or give 1,4-aryl migration products. Regioselective radical addition of phenethanethiol (1b) to enynes 3-6 gives radicals 11-14 which undergo five- or six-membered cyclization onto the alkene double bond; the stereoelectronically disfavored 6-exo cyclization can compete with intermolecular hydrogen abstraction and (to a small extent) with 1,5-hydrogen migration. The 5- and 6-(pi-exo)exo cyclization of vinyl radicals 7, 9, 11-13 is highly stereoselective and exclusively or predominately affords products deriving from the (Z)-isomers. Stereochemical evidence indicates that the six-membered endo-cyclization products 30 and 50 could derive from a direct 6-endo cyclization of (E)-radicals (E)-10 and (E)-14 rather than from a 5-exo cyclization/ring expansion process. Sulfanyl radical addition to enynes 3-5 is highly regioselective to the terminal triple bond. In contrast, reaction elf thiols 1a,b with enyne 6 leads to products deriving from sulfanyl radical addition to both the CC triple and double bond. This behavior is accounted for by assuming that sulfanyl radical addition to the alkyne triple bond is not reversible, while the addition to the alkene double bond is. Vinyl radical 10 affords product 33 by a rare 1,4-hydrogen migration/fragmentation process.
